QIBA FDG-PET/CT ROI Definition Technical Subcommittee Charge
The objectives of this subcommittee are:
- 1) To survey the existing ROI capabilities and definitions on workstations being used for PET image interpretation.
- 2) To make recommendations for common ROI definitions to be implemented by all vendors.
- 3) To guide the implementation of the recommended definitions.
Items to consider include, but are not limited to:
- 2D vs. 3D ROI's
- ROI's defined in different orthogonal planes
- Meaning of circular ROI's (which pixels are included; is there weighting?)
- Thresholding capabilities
- ROI's on zoomed images
